Service Mesh Unwrapped: Learn About the Future of Application Connectivity

Event Ended
March 16, 2020

Service mesh is the future of application connectivity, and it delivers immediate value to any architecture by increasing the security, reliability and observability of our application traffic. At the same time, our industry has made it challenging to understand and deploy service mesh in production - but it doesn’t have to be this way.

In this webinar, Kong CTO & Co-Founder Marco Palladino will take you from understanding the basics of service mesh to conceptualizing the most advanced topics, while demonstrating how your team can easily deploy service mesh in production in a few minutes on both modern Kubernetes platforms and more traditional VM-based ones.

Key takeaways:

  • The key concepts, benefits and pitfalls of service mesh
  • Why leveraging service mesh results in reliable modern applications
  • How your team can deploy service mesh in production in a few minutes
